DRESSING · ROAST BEEF & GRILLED MEATS
In the published recipe, this is the dressing for rosbife com vinagrete de pimenta biquinho.
Buffara's biquinho pepper vinaigrette for roast beef.

Ratio
Ingredients
- Olive Oilabout 6 Tbsp (100 ml)
- Butter3 Tbsp (44 ml)
- Onionabout 1½ onions (150 g)
- Biquinho Peppe200 g
- Sugar¼ cup (50 g)
- Lemon Juice1/3 cup lemon juice (80 ml)
- Olive Oil2 Tbsp (30 ml)

Provenance
Manu Buffara. Brazilian / Paraná. Cited awards include: Latin America's 50 Best: Best Female Chef 2022; Latin America's 50 Best (Manu).
Originally published as Vinagrete Pimenta Biquinho.
